Top Picks for Family Restaurants
Looking for the best family restaurants in Jacksonville, FL? You’ll find many local favorites and new spots to try. These places offer fun menus, great atmospheres, and unforgettable meals.
Celebrated Local Favorites
The Bearded Pig is famous for its tasty BBQ and outdoor play area. ABBQ in Atlantic Beach has a courtyard with games for kids. Timoti’s Seafood Shak even has a pirate ship playground.
Newer Hotspots Worth Trying
For new options, check out Midtown Table near St. Johns Town Center. It has outdoor games and a putting green. Main Street Food Park in Springfield offers a food truck vibe with games and a small playground.

Pizzerias That Everyone Will Love
Local pizzerias in Jacksonville, like V Pizza, are big hits with families. They have playgrounds and chalk walls, making them fun for kids. Mellow Mushroom is another favorite, known for its creative pizzas in a fun, laid-back setting.
Burger Joints with Diverse Menus
For those who love burgers, Jacksonville has some great spots. M Shack and Cruisers Grill offer a wide range of options. They have everything from classic burgers to unique toppings and sides.

Restaurants with Play Areas for Kids
Jacksonville, Florida, has many family-friendly restaurants. Some are special because they have play areas for kids. These places make sure everyone has a great time while eating.
Bravoz Entertainment Center: A One-Stop Destination for Fun and Dining
Bravoz Entertainment Center is a top spot for fun dining with kids in Jacksonville. It has lots of fun activities, like high-ropes courses and virtual reality. Parents can enjoy a meal while kids play in the big play areas.
Adventure Landing: Where Family Fun Meets Culinary Delights
Adventure Landing is great for kid-friendly restaurants in Jacksonville. It has mini-golf, go-karts, and an arcade. Families can eat and have fun together at this place.
Chuck E. Cheese: A Classic Pizza-and-Play Experience
Chuck E. Cheese is a must-visit for fun dining with kids in Jacksonville. It offers a fun mix of pizza and play areas. Kids can play safely while parents enjoy tasty food.
These places make sure kids are safe while playing. Restaurants like Wicked Barley Brewing Company even have outdoor dining. They have a boardwalk and hammocks, making it even more fun for families.

Upscale Restaurants with Children’s Menus
Barbara Jean’s is a favorite for its Southern dishes and family vibe. Kids can enjoy grilled chicken, mac and cheese, and mini cheeseburgers. Valley Smoke, known for its BBQ and drinks, also has a kids’ menu. It includes chicken tenders and mini corn dogs.
Tips for Dining with Kids in Upscale Environments
- Call ahead to inquire about specific kid-friendly offerings and reservations during peak hours.
- Look for restaurants with outdoor seating or private dining rooms to provide a more enclosed, controlled environment for families.
- Bring along engaging activities, such as coloring books or small toys, to keep little ones entertained while waiting for the meal.
- Be mindful of your children’s behavior and consider the needs of other diners when dining in upscale settings.

Family-Friendly Vietnamese Cuisine
For a taste of Vietnam, try Pho Today and Bowl of Pho. These restaurants in Jacksonville, FL, serve up Vietnamese staples like fragrant pho and vermicelli noodle dishes. They also have flavorful rice plates. Parents can enjoy authentic Vietnamese flavors, while kids have milder options.
Kid-Approved Italian Eateries
Italian food is a hit with everyone, and family-oriented restaurants jacksonville fl like Carrabba’s Italian Grill and Maggiano’s Little Italy are no exception. They have big kids’ menus with pasta, pizza, and chicken tenders. This ensures a great dining experience for the whole family.

Parks with Scenic Views
Palm Valley Outdoors Bar & Grill is by the St. Johns River. It offers beautiful views of the Intracoastal Waterway. It’s a great spot for families looking for a peaceful meal with nature.
Sliders Seaside Grill in Fernandina Beach has beachfront dining. There’s a playground for kids, and parents can enjoy fresh seafood and the sea view.
Restaurants with Patios
The The Bearded Pig has big outdoor areas with games for kids. It’s perfect for enjoying Jacksonville’s weather and tasty barbecue. Other places like Congaree and Penn, The District, and Culhane’s Irish Pub have rooftop bars with great views.

Restaurants Featuring Live Music and Entertainment
Looking for a lively place to eat? Several family-oriented restaurants jacksonville fl have live music nights. Wicked Barley Brewing Company is a favorite spot for live music of all kinds. Top Dawg Tavern also has a Kids Club every Wednesday, with fun activities for the little ones.
Special Events for Kids
- Main Event, a family entertainment center, offers free meals for kids under 12 on Tuesdays. It’s a great choice for families watching their budget.
- Picasso’s, a local pizza place, lets kids make their own pizzas from 5:00 – 6:30 pm daily. It’s a fun, interactive way to enjoy a meal.
- Chicken On Wheels, a family-friendly spot, has a deal for a whole rotisserie chicken with sides and a 2-liter drink for just $22. It’s perfect for families looking for a hearty, affordable meal.
